Call LIVE Agent NOW
+1-888-376-9286
90/12 Moo 5 T. Saku Thalang Phuket , Nai Yang Beach
0.1 mi from center
See availability

90/4 Moo 5 Saku Thalang Phuket, Nai Yang Beach
0.1 mi from center
See availability

65/23-24 Nai Yang Beach Road Tumbol Sakhu Thalang, Nai Yang Beach
0.1 mi from center
See availability

90 Moo 5 Saku Thalang Phuket, Nai Yang Beach
0.1 mi from center
See availability

90/34 Moo 5 T. Saku A. Thalang, Nai Yang Beach
0.1 mi from center
See availability

90/24 Moo 5 Saku Thalang Phuket, Nai Yang Beach
0.1 mi from center
See availability

116 Moo 1 Tambol Sakhu Talang Phuket, Nai Yang Beach
0.2 mi from center
See availability

112 Moo.5 Sakhu Thalang, Nai Yang Beach
0.2 mi from center
See availability

113 Moo 5 Sakoo Thalang, Nai Yang Beach
0.2 mi from center
See availability

199 Moo 1 Sakoo Thalang, Nai Yang Beach
0.2 mi from center
See availability





24-h Check-in
Early Check-in
Late Check-in
Self Check-in